1

The Basic Principles Of best pet shop dubai

News Discuss 
With above twelve,000 products, you will discover each and every small thing during the best pet food, treatment and equipment from best & unique brands. Shop on the web and get your orders the exact same working working day and even the next Interspersed Among the many cluttered shows are https://pet-supplies-dubai18518.bloggactivo.com/34360613/what-does-best-pet-store-dubai-mean

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story